Sakumo within this story is a slave of the Holy Empire, taken away as a prisoner of war during the crushing of Bast. He lost an arm during the conflict but due to his unwavering will and ability to defeat many opponents in unarmed combat, he was instead beaten to exhaustion to then be taken away to the work prison “Rebirth” (shown top right) to undergo a loss of willpower and indoctrination to convert him into a holy warrior or into fertilizer. As a result from the combat he endured before being imprisoned, he has lost use of an arm, however it has hindered his abilities very little and only made him focus his strength much more into his existing arm.

Past Life

He is a farmer from the region of Bast, a former United Cities citizen. Sakumo’s former life as a samurai for the United Cities has left him with experience in martial arts and heavy weapons. He has served with a company of samurai to defend several trading capitals within The Great Desert and has been a part of a personal guard for the Emperor during a celebration of the Slave Festival. After spending over a decade within the service of nobles and rich merchants, Sakumo traveled through the world for a time to work as a for hire swordsman and escort, he typically would guide many into harsh environments such as the Deadlands due to the settlement Black Desert City, a place renowned for its weapon and armor smiths, as well as its rich archives of information. Due to his extensive time spent traveling from there and back, he has many acid burns and scars from the time spent in the toxic rain, bleaching his hair to a point of no return.

    Katsu (Victory in Japanese) was a Skeleton from the days of the Old Empire.

She was a ruthless Shinobi within Cat-Lon’s Empire, known for her skills in martial arts and assassinations, she was a scourge on those few human rebellions that tried to make a foothold during the Empire’s reign. However, due to her ruthless nature she was regarded as a monster by some of her allies within the Empire, most notably, Masamune who disapproved of her methods of extermination and control. Her pride did not let Masamune make such comments and so forth a duel took place between the two Skeletons. However, Masamune was a much more skilled and merciful warrior and when he decided to spare her life, she took his mercy as weakness and in doing so tried to attack him once he was walked away, but her hate was her downfall as Masamune sunk a blade into her chest and pulled his sword upwards, cutting her in two. 

She fell to the ground, trying to move but she felt her final moments making its way, too much damage was done to make a recovery, so she put her intellect and power all into hibernation. Burn, Katsu’s mentor and partner, found her after the battle and took her to a repair bed to try and mend what was left of her, but nothing could be done as protocols within her systems prevent any tampering. Burn kept her top piece with him for many years, leaving the life of the Empire to protect her and tend to her, as he believed she would recover one day. 

However in time, her body too was rusting away and drastic measures had to be made, the only useable and mendable parts of her left not bound by rust or age was her left arm. With no options, he bound her machine spirit and mind within that area and kept her attached to a generator. Within these times he would hear faint jitters and groans of gears within that arm, her soul still alive. At times Burn considered mutilating himself just so he could have her back but he knew her rage would infect his machine spirit and he would not be the kind man he once was, but a mutant of machine spirits and their minds would leave to degradation of intense decline.

As the story reach present, Burn has come to accept the loss of Katsu, still protecting her arm as he promised himself he would, but a human Samurai warrior, Sakumo, would meet the old retired bounty hunter who had nothing left but time to spend and the two would speak in friendly terms. Burn would see that Sakumo might have been someone he needed to meet as Sakumo was missing his left arm. Seeing the soul of youth, rage and desperation, he gifted the arm of Katsu to Sakumo, in hopes that both Sakumo and Katsu would find peace and justice in this new world, one trying to avenge what was taken and another to accept what has come.

This is an excerpt from the Kenshi Wiki regarding the Holy Nation.


The Holy Nation is a theocratic human state that controls a notable portion of the northwest lands of Kenshi. They are ruled by a "Phoenix" whom they believe to be a reincarnation of their first ruler.[1] Their religion, Okranism, is based around the dualism of the Okran, Lord Of Light, and Narko, Demoness of Darkness.[2] Holy Nation citizens are often interchangeably referred to as Okranites[3].

They are a xenophobic, zealous, and luddite society that rejects high-tech science and technology, oppresses women, non-human races, and anyone who does not agree with their religious beliefs.[2] Male Humans sit atop their societal hierarchy, with no distinction made between Greenlanders or Scorchlanders. Passing patrols may heal injured human player characters or provide food if starving. Take care if knocked out nearby a slave camp however, as they have no problem with enslaving unconscious characters. Some activities within the Holy Nation are limited to male humans, such as turning in bounties, or interacting with certain NPCs.

This section is taken from the Kenshi Wiki 


"The Armour King is a Skeleton merchant who sells Armour gear in Armour King's Shop. He is a masterful armoursmith who produces high-end armor to give travelers superior protection.

Worth noting, he is extremely skilled in combat and is also protected by his Security Spider II sentries, and his personal thralls, who are also extremely skilled. He is one of a few traders who actively follows player's character around the shop and some way outside it as well.

He can be found at the Drowned Ruins in the northwest of the map, in the river next to the Arm of Okran. The only way to reach him is by swimming along the river, entering either from the south side near Blister Hill or the west side near Floodlands."
